Abstract
A pressure transmission device includes a main part and a separating membrane secured to the main part. A pressure chamber is formed between the separating membrane and a surface, with the pressure chamber communicating with a hydraulic path. The separating membrane is: supplied with the process medium from a first membrane side; the pressure chamber and the hydraulic path are filled with a transmission fluid; the separating membrane is connected to the main part; and the separating membrane has a central region. The device additionally comprises a temperature sensor and a mount, wherein the temperature sensor introduced into the mount. The mount is arranged in a central cavity in such a way that a surface of the mount facing the separating membrane lies on a plane relative to the central region such that the surface of the mount acts as an abutment for the separating membrane when pressure is applied.
